Icy Strait Point sits on Chichagof Island, about a mile from the Tlingit village of Hoonah. It's a purpose-built cruise port that still feels remote. Humpback whales surface in the strait regularly, and the surrounding forest smells of pine and saltwater. The Adventure Center near the dock offers activities ranging from the ZipRider, a 1,300-foot zipline with views over the coastline, to kayaking in the protected waters of Port Frederick. Brown bear viewing excursions are one of Chichagof Island's best draws, as the island has one of the highest bear densities in the world. The restored Hoonah Packing Company Cannery shows the history of Alaska's canning industry and serves fresh local salmon. The Native Heritage Center hosts Tlingit drumming, dancing, and storytelling. The walk to Hoonah is about 1.5 miles along a scenic road, though shuttles run too. Bring cash for smaller vendors.
